The reduced form of a game

Author

Listed:
  • Vermeulen, D.
  • Jansen, M.J.M.

    (Quantitative Economics)

Abstract

The goal of this paper is twofold. Firstly a short proof of the unicity of the reduced form of a normal form game is provided, using a technique to reduce a game originally introduced by Mertens. Secondly a direct combinatorial-geometric interpretation of the reduced form is described. This description is then used to derive an algorithm for the calculation of the reduced form of a game.
